Understanding the Cost of Resin Hoses A Guide to Quotes
When it comes to purchasing resin hoses, understanding the various factors that influence pricing is crucial for both individuals and businesses looking to make a smart investment. Resin hoses, known for their flexibility and chemical resistance, are widely used across several industries, including agriculture, manufacturing, and construction. However, the price of these hoses can vary dramatically based on several key factors. In this article, we will delve into the aspects that determine the cost and how to obtain accurate quotes.
1. Material Quality
The quality of the resin used in the hoses significantly affects pricing. High-grade materials tend to be more expensive but offer better durability and resistance to chemicals. For applications involving aggressive fluids, investing in premium resin hoses can save costs in the long run through reduced maintenance and replacement needs. When requesting quotes, be sure to verify the specifications concerning material quality.
2. Hose Specifications
Different applications require different hose specifications, including length, diameter, and pressure ratings. Custom specifications often lead to variations in cost. For instance, a hose designed to withstand high pressure will generally be priced higher than a standard one. When comparing quotes, always ensure that you are comparing like-for-like products based on your specific requirements.
3. Supplier Reputation and Location
The reputation of the supplier can significantly influence pricing. Established manufacturers with a long-standing reputation for quality may charge more than newer or less-known competitors. Additionally, geographical location plays a role in cost; local suppliers might offer lower shipping fees, while international vendors may provide better prices for bulk orders but higher shipping rates.
4. Order Quantity
Bulk purchasing often leads to cost savings, as many suppliers offer discounts for larger orders. If you plan to buy in bulk, it’s beneficial to request quotes that reflect different quantities so that you can evaluate the best financial option. However, always consider your actual needs to avoid unnecessary expenses tied to over-purchasing.
5. Market Trends
Market dynamics can influence the pricing of resin hoses. Factors like fluctuating material prices, changes in demand, or global supply chain disruptions can affect costs. Keeping an eye on industry trends can aid in timing your purchase for better pricing. Engaging with suppliers who provide insights about market conditions can also be advantageous.
6. Requesting Quotes
When looking to buy resin hoses, it’s advisable to obtain multiple quotes from different suppliers. Be clear about your required specifications, expected delivery times, and any additional services, such as installation or maintenance. This clarity ensures that the quotes you receive are accurate and comparable.
